Crusher - Wikipedia

A crusher is a machine designed to reduce large rocks into smaller rocks, gravel, sand or rock dust.. Crushers may be used to reduce the size, or change the form, of waste materials so they can be more easily disposed of or recycled, or to reduce the size of a solid mix of raw materials (as in rock ore), so that pieces of different composition can be differentiated.

Dynamic mechanical analysis - Wikipedia

Dynamic mechanical analysis (abbreviated DMA) is a technique used to study and characterize materials. It is most useful for studying the viscoelastic behavior of polymers. A sinusoidal stress is applied and the strain in the material is measured, allowing one to determine the complex modulus.

classification of jaw crushers

Apr 05, 2021· Crusher - Wikipedia. 2019-10-30 Jaw crushers are heavy duty machines and hence need to be robustly constructed. The outer frame is generally made of cast iron or steel. The jaws themselves are usually constructed from cast steel. They are fitted with replaceable liners which are made of manganese steel, or Ni-hard (a Ni-Cr alloyed cast iron).

Dynamic Characteristics of Crusher Supporting Structures

Dynamic Loads The dynamic loads induced by the operation of crushers are of two types: 1) Unbalanced forces caused by rotor-eccentricity and loss of hammers. 2) Shock forces induced by the impact action of hammers. The unbalanced forces caused the residual unbalance

2.10: Dynamic Mechanical Analysis - Chemistry LibreTexts

Mar 21, 2021· Dynamic mechanical analysis (DMA), also known as forced oscillatory measurements and dynamic rheology, is a basic tool used to measure the viscoelastic properties of materials (particularly polymers). Jaw Crusher - an overview | ScienceDirect Topics

For a jaw crusher the thickness of the largest particle should not normally exceed 80–85% of the gape. Assuming in this case the largest particle to be crushed is 85% of the gape, then the gape of the crusher should be = 45.7/0.85 = 53.6 cm and for a shape factor of 1.7, the width should be = 45.7 × 1.7 = 78 cm.
